The following warnings occurred:
Warning [2] Use of undefined constant SAPI_NAME - assumed 'SAPI_NAME' (this will throw an Error in a future version of PHP) - Line: 3388 - File: inc/functions.php PHP 7.4.33-nmm7 (Linux)
File Line Function
/inc/functions.php 3388 errorHandler->error
/showthread.php 116 build_archive_link
Warning [2] Use of undefined constant IN_ARCHIVE - assumed 'IN_ARCHIVE' (this will throw an Error in a future version of PHP) - Line: 3331 - File: inc/functions.php PHP 7.4.33-nmm7 (Linux)
File Line Function
/inc/functions.php 3331 errorHandler->error
/inc/functions.php 3324 build_forum_breadcrumb
/showthread.php 195 build_forum_breadcrumb
Warning [2] Use of undefined constant IN_ARCHIVE - assumed 'IN_ARCHIVE' (this will throw an Error in a future version of PHP) - Line: 3331 - File: inc/functions.php PHP 7.4.33-nmm7 (Linux)
File Line Function
/inc/functions.php 3331 errorHandler->error
/showthread.php 195 build_forum_breadcrumb






Post Reply 
 
Thread Rating:
  • 1 Votes - 5 Average
  • 1
  • 2
  • 3
  • 4
  • 5
56b Nightly vs Pre-release
Author Message
Mordaunt
Super Moderator
****

Posts: 1,237
Likes Given: 26
Likes Received: 55 in 43 posts
Joined: Mar 2012
Reputation: 35



Post: #1
56b Nightly vs Pre-release
For years people have moaned and complained that 56b is only available in a nightly form, unless you wanted to use a really old pre-release.

Now we have the 2013 Pre-release. The last version of 56b that will be released (development now having moved on to 56c), and people are refusing and reluctant to upgrade to it

This leaves me in a state of bewilderment.

The 2013 pre-release is more stable, less buggy and has more features than earlier versions.
There are no syntax changes to scripting through out the 56b version.
Scripts that work with the earliest version of 56b should work perfectly fine with the last version, though the 2013 pre-release offers some options that can be worked into your scripts to make them more efficient. (notice I said can be worked into, not must be worked into or your server will explode)
Upgrading really only requires a handful of sphere.ini changes, it is the work of minutes, compared to the work of hours/days whining and moaning on the forums about how a script doesn't work with an old version of the server.

There is no valid reason for not upgrading a server running ANY version of 56b to the 2013 pre-release

If you are running any of the 56b nightlies and you have an issue step 1, before you even think of posting should be to upgrade.
Anything else only succeeds in wasting time, yours and everyone trying to help you.

[Image: 2nis46r.jpg]
(This post was last modified: 09-22-2013 11:48 PM by Mordaunt.)
09-22-2013 11:48 PM
Visit this user's website Find all posts by this user Like Post Quote this message in a reply
uowod
Apprentice
*

Posts: 3
Likes Given: 0
Likes Received: 1 in 1 posts
Joined: Nov 2013
Reputation: 0



Post: #2
RE: 56b Nightly vs Pre-release
Hello,

I tried to use the March Pre-Release in my shard, the same as some previous Nightly Builds, and they had some problems which made them useless for a live shard.

These are the problems I remember at this moment (the test was some months ago):

- When you enter a moongate ingame or you are teleported and the destination has some items, the items take much more time to load than the version we are using, no matter what configuration you use in sphere.ini.

- When you enter a moongate while running and you keep running after crossing it, most of the times the server will pull your player back to the teleporting position before leting you move.

- At least in the Nightly Builds there were random crashes without any notice in the console or logs. I don't know if this continued in the Pre-Release.

- The Pre-Release use a lot more CPU time than the previous versions, thus allowing less player to play at the same time.

- I don't remember at this moment what it was, but we found a big bug that couldn't be solved and forced us to change back again the version.

With the current version we use (Sep 2008 Pre-Release) we don't have any of these problems. Of course I would like to use the newer version because of the new features it has, but all the versions we tried wasn't "less buggy" or "more stable".

After those tests I tried for a couple of weeks to contact a developer in the chat to report the problems, but I was completely ignored so I decided to desist.

I have to lose completely some days of work to fully test a version before installing it in the server. Do you know about these bugs and do you know if they are fixed in the June Pre-Release?

Regards
11-06-2013 04:51 AM
Find all posts by this user Like Post Quote this message in a reply
XuN
Sphere Developer
*****

Posts: 852
Likes Given: 102
Likes Received: 156 in 119 posts
Joined: Jul 2013
Reputation: 30



Post: #3
RE: 56b Nightly vs Pre-release
More features = more cpu, btw this kind of things must be reported with some information about exact number of items, trying without events in players, and further testing, in the bugtracker... some devs are inactive so they may not read your msg... the bugtracker is always operative.
11-06-2013 05:46 AM
Find all posts by this user Like Post Quote this message in a reply
darksun84
Sir Spamalot
****

Posts: 1,687
Likes Given: 245
Likes Received: 162 in 151 posts
Joined: Mar 2012
Reputation: 35



Post: #4
RE: 56b Nightly vs Pre-release
I don't remeber any prerelease in the March 2013 Shock
The last one was launched in June and the previous one was in the september 2009.
11-06-2013 05:53 AM
Find all posts by this user Like Post Quote this message in a reply
Mordaunt
Super Moderator
****

Posts: 1,237
Likes Given: 26
Likes Received: 55 in 43 posts
Joined: Mar 2012
Reputation: 35



Post: #5
RE: 56b Nightly vs Pre-release
(11-06-2013 04:51 AM)uowod Wrote:  Hello,

I tried to use the March Pre-Release in my shard, the same as some previous Nightly Builds, and they had some problems which made them useless for a live shard.

There is no March prerelease

These are the problems I remember at this moment (the test was some months ago):

- When you enter a moongate ingame or you are teleported and the destination has some items, the items take much more time to load than the version we are using, no matter what configuration you use in sphere.ini.

How old is the computer you are running the server on?

- When you enter a moongate while running and you keep running after crossing it, most of the times the server will pull your player back to the teleporting position before leting you move.

This sounds like an issue with your moongate script more than anything thing else

- At least in the Nightly Builds there were random crashes without any notice in the console or logs. I don't know if this continued in the Pre-Release.

The nightly has been extremely stable for a long time, crashes tend to occur when scripts cause them

- The Pre-Release use a lot more CPU time than the previous versions, thus allowing less player to play at the same time.

While this is true, it is only really an issue if your computer is older than me

- I don't remember at this moment what it was, but we found a big bug that couldn't be solved and forced us to change back again the version.

If you don't know what it was how can we help?

With the current version we use (Sep 2008 Pre-Release) we don't have any of these problems. Of course I would like to use the newer version because of the new features it has, but all the versions we tried wasn't "less buggy" or "more stable".

After those tests I tried for a couple of weeks to contact a developer in the chat to report the problems, but I was completely ignored so I decided to desist.

While we have an IRC the devs do have jobs/lives outside of sphereserver and cannot man the room 24/7. There are often people in the room who may be able to assist but again obviously we are not constantly glued to the screen so a little patience is required. Alternatively you can post here to the forums and someone will in time reply.

I have to lose completely some days of work to fully test a version before installing it in the server. Do you know about these bugs and do you know if they are fixed in the June Pre-Release?

The 2013 prerelease is fine for use as a live server, that is why it is a prerelease and not a nightly which often contains warnings about using for a live server (though most nightlies actually ARE fine to run live)

Regards

[Image: 2nis46r.jpg]
(This post was last modified: 11-06-2013 06:16 AM by Mordaunt.)
11-06-2013 06:00 AM
Visit this user's website Find all posts by this user Like Post Quote this message in a reply
uowod
Apprentice
*

Posts: 3
Likes Given: 0
Likes Received: 1 in 1 posts
Joined: Nov 2013
Reputation: 0



Post: #6
RE: 56b Nightly vs Pre-release
Yeah, yeah, I was a dumbass expecting other kind of reply to my message. Don't worry, it's ok. By the way, I've been running a live server for "only" 11 years, but you can talk to me as if I was a noob. If there isn't a March Pre-Release then the files I've found are from a Nightly build in March and the Pre-Release I tried was the June one. Anyways, forget it. I will try the 56c version and won't appear here anymore as I don't think this is a community anymore. I'm sorry but the way you talk to the people is awful.
11-06-2013 08:14 AM
Find all posts by this user Like Post Quote this message in a reply
Mordaunt
Super Moderator
****

Posts: 1,237
Likes Given: 26
Likes Received: 55 in 43 posts
Joined: Mar 2012
Reputation: 35



Post: #7
RE: 56b Nightly vs Pre-release
I see that you are of the mentality that takes offense where there is no reason to, accusing me of talking to you as if you were a "noob"
You asked questions/made statements, I have answered them.
What exactly were you looking for?

[Image: 2nis46r.jpg]
11-06-2013 08:42 AM
Visit this user's website Find all posts by this user Like Post Quote this message in a reply
x77x
Master
**

Posts: 488
Likes Given: 0
Likes Received: 15 in 15 posts
Joined: Mar 2012
Reputation: -4



Post: #8
RE: 56b Nightly vs Pre-release
have a YEARLY release (aka the pre-release)
and have a MONTHY build instead of a nightly

less confusing

or

don't publish the nightly, make it devs only...


and anytime you touch anything script wise, make sure the logs and the header dates are updated

Dragons of Time 2000-2020
http://dragonsoftime.com
(This post was last modified: 11-06-2013 09:38 AM by x77x.)
11-06-2013 09:34 AM
Find all posts by this user Like Post Quote this message in a reply
Post Reply 


Forum Jump:


User(s) browsing this thread: 1 Guest(s)